CORSO CHINA APPEAL
Sir, —As the May appeal for CORSO aid to the Chinese people gathers momentum throughout the country we report that donations received to date in CORSO Dominion headquarters now aggregate £3,120, and included in this is the total of £lO received direct from donors living in' and ..around Whakatane. To this figure must be added any donations which you have kindly received for the appeal Some donors were anonymous, so we should be particularly grateful if you would kindly publish this acknowledgment. Yours etc., COLIN W. MORRISON,
Dominion Secretary-Treasurer for C.0.R.5.0. Wellington, May 18.
